##// END OF EJS Templates
exceptions: improved reporting of unhandled vcsserver exceptions
exceptions: improved reporting of unhandled vcsserver exceptions

File last commit:

r4534:5ad2c43b default
r4535:d67d12de default
Show More
files_browser.mako
100 lines | 4.2 KiB | application/x-mako | MakoHtmlLexer
templating: use .mako as extensions for template files.
r1282
<div id="codeblock" class="browserblock">
<div class="browser-header">
<div class="browser-nav">
gravatars: reduce the size of fonts inside the initials gravatar
r3654
templating: use .mako as extensions for template files.
r1282 <div class="info_box">
gravatars: reduce the size of fonts inside the initials gravatar
r3654
templating: use .mako as extensions for template files.
r1282 <div class="info_box_elem previous">
files: made file filter an active input instead of a button.
r3694 <a id="prev_commit_link" data-commit-id="${c.prev_commit.raw_id}" class=" ${('disabled' if c.url_prev == '#' else '')}" href="${c.url_prev}" title="${_('Previous commit')}"><i class="icon-left"></i></a>
templating: use .mako as extensions for template files.
r1282 </div>
gravatars: reduce the size of fonts inside the initials gravatar
r3654
${h.hidden('refs_filter')}
templating: use .mako as extensions for template files.
r1282 <div class="info_box_elem next">
files: made file filter an active input instead of a button.
r3694 <a id="next_commit_link" data-commit-id="${c.next_commit.raw_id}" class=" ${('disabled' if c.url_next == '#' else '')}" href="${c.url_next}" title="${_('Next commit')}"><i class="icon-right"></i></a>
templating: use .mako as extensions for template files.
r1282 </div>
</div>
% if h.HasRepoPermissionAny('repository.write','repository.admin')(c.repo_name):
dan
ui: added secondary action instead of two buttons on files page....
r4449
<div class="new-file">
<div class="btn-group btn-group-actions">
<a class="btn btn-primary no-margin" href="${h.route_path('repo_files_add_file',repo_name=c.repo_name,commit_id=c.commit.raw_id,f_path=c.f_path)}">
${_('Add File')}
</a>
dan
ui: make the action buttons with more-option have a divider + removed inline styles.
r4452 <a class="tooltip btn btn-primary btn-more-option" data-toggle="dropdown" aria-pressed="false" role="button" title="${_('more options')}">
dan
ui: added secondary action instead of two buttons on files page....
r4449 <i class="icon-down"></i>
</a>
dan
downloads: added more archive options that we support. Exposing this to users so they actually...
r4450 <div class="btn-action-switcher-container right-align">
dan
ui: added secondary action instead of two buttons on files page....
r4449 <ul class="btn-action-switcher" role="menu" style="min-width: 200px">
<li>
<a class="action_button" href="${h.route_path('repo_files_upload_file',repo_name=c.repo_name,commit_id=c.commit.raw_id,f_path=c.f_path)}">
<i class="icon-upload"></i>
${_('Upload File')}
</a>
</li>
</ul>
</div>
</div>
</div>
templating: use .mako as extensions for template files.
r1282 % endif
Liviu
files view changes: moved add file, download and search to the right, added paddings and margins
r3695
dan
Files: expose downloads onto files view
r3374 % if c.enable_downloads:
files: change download title for button
r3700 <% at_path = '{}'.format(request.GET.get('at') or c.commit.raw_id[:6]) %>
<div class="btn btn-default new-file">
files: updated based on new design
r3706 % if c.f_path == '/':
<a href="${h.route_path('repo_archivefile',repo_name=c.repo_name, fname='{}.zip'.format(c.commit.raw_id))}">
${_('Download full tree ZIP')}
</a>
% else:
archvies: allowing to obtain archives without the commit short id in the name for better automation of obtained artifacts.
r4534 <a href="${h.route_path('repo_archivefile',repo_name=c.repo_name, fname='{}.zip'.format(c.commit.raw_id), _query={'at_path':c.f_path, 'with_hash': '1'})}">
files: updated based on new design
r3706 ${_('Download this tree ZIP')}
</a>
% endif
dan
Files: expose downloads onto files view
r3374 </div>
% endif
files: made file filter an active input instead of a button.
r3694
Liviu
files view changes: moved add file, download and search to the right, added paddings and margins
r3695 <div class="files-quick-filter">
<ul class="files-filter-box">
<li class="files-filter-box-path">
<i class="icon-search"></i>
</li>
<li class="files-filter-box-input">
<input onkeydown="NodeFilter.initFilter(event)" class="init" type="text" placeholder="Quick filter" name="filter" size="25" id="node_filter" autocomplete="off">
</li>
</ul>
</div>
templating: use .mako as extensions for template files.
r1282 </div>
</div>
files: updated based on new design
r3706
templating: use .mako as extensions for template files.
r1282 ## file tree is computed from caches, and filled in
<div id="file-tree">
files: ported repository files controllers to pyramid views.
r1927 ${c.file_tree |n}
templating: use .mako as extensions for template files.
r1282 </div>
files: render readme files found in repository file browser....
r3924 %if c.readme_data:
<div id="readme" class="anchor">
<div class="box">
landing-refs: create helpers for landing ref to make clear indication about type/name
r4370 <div class="readme-title" title="${h.tooltip(_('Readme file from commit %s:%s') % (c.rhodecode_db_repo.landing_ref_type, c.rhodecode_db_repo.landing_ref_name))}">
ui: make readme header nicer
r4097 <div>
<i class="icon-file-text"></i>
landing-refs: create helpers for landing ref to make clear indication about type/name
r4370 <a href="${h.route_path('repo_files',repo_name=c.repo_name,commit_id=c.rhodecode_db_repo.landing_ref_name,f_path=c.readme_file)}">
files: render readme files found in repository file browser....
r3924 ${c.readme_file}
</a>
ui: make readme header nicer
r4097 </div>
files: render readme files found in repository file browser....
r3924 </div>
<div class="readme codeblock">
<div class="readme_box">
${c.readme_data|n}
</div>
</div>
</div>
</div>
%endif
templating: use .mako as extensions for template files.
r1282 </div>